West Alabama Homeowners: Roof Repair Grants Available

Tuscaloosa, AL, January 17, 2026 Habitat for Humanity of Tuscaloosa is launching a new initiative to support homeowners in four West Alabama counties with grants of up to $10,000 for roof repairs. Tuscaloosa County Commission Proposes $100K for Northside Park

Tuscaloosa County, AL, January 17, 2026 The Tuscaloosa County Commission is considering a $100,000 investment for new playground equipment at PARA’s Northside Park. This initiative, led by Commissioner Stan Acker, aims to enhance community well-being and support local economic growth. Athens Welcomes New Food City, Boosting Economic Growth

Athens, Alabama, January 14, 2026 Athens, Alabama is celebrating the groundbreaking of a new $7.6 million Food City grocery store, which promises to create 180 jobs and enhance local economic opportunities. North Huntsville’s Retail Future Takes Shape with Major Development

Huntsville, AL, January 9, 2026 A $240 million retail and restaurant development, the North Village Town Center, is progressing in North Huntsville. This ambitious project aims to create over 600,000 square feet of new retail space, enhance local economic vitality, and provide diverse opportunities for the community. Huntsville’s Butcher Drafting Service: Six Decades of Innovation

Huntsville, January 6, 2026 Celebrating over sixty years of exceptional service, Butcher Drafting Service has been integral to Huntsville’s growth. Founded by Joe and Betty Butcher, the company adapted from hand-drawn plans to advanced computer-aided design.
